Our view/Local Government Aid: More predictability, fewer politics: Yes!
Look no further than Duluth to see all that has been maddening and wrong with the way the state doles out local government aid, or LGA, as it’s commonly known. Year after year, especially in recent years, City Hall and the City Council have drafted and approved budgets only to be left scrambling when millions in LGA suddenly were yanked away. And remember in 2010 when the Republican-controlled House proposed stripping Duluth and other DFL-dominated cities of all LGA while leaving unscathed Republican strongholds like Rochester?
